Remote viewing is a method that allows you to collect information to which you do not have direct access by relying on intuition. Remote viewing was notably developed as part of a series of experiments carried out by the American intelligence services. Documents dating from 1983 recently declassified by the CIA allow us to know a little more about this astonishing story. The artist duo Raffard-Roussel offer an immersive conference which retraces the history of remote viewing. During this didactic performance, participants are invited to develop their extra-lucid abilities to in turn become psychonauts capable of traveling outside their bodily envelope to visit distant landscapes.
